Sailing, fishing, spear fishing, surfing, living off the land and adventure in general runs in Fraser’s blood. Fraser started out dingy sailing, and then coastal cruising on small sail boats and power boats on the northeastern coast of New Zealand before heading offshore to work in the superyacht industry. He is a natural captain, a qualified marine engineer and has a Bachelor of Science in Marine and Coastal Ecology. With an insatiable appetite for adventure, this captain is well suited to guests looking to get off the beaten track to search for adventure and adrenaline. Whether you are new to water sports or want to improve your skills, Fraser has a knack for identifying the correct tips to pass on to those wanting to learn surfing, freediving, e-foiling or wake surfing. After his time engineering in the tug and barge industry there is seldom anything that Fraser cannot fix, so rest easy knowing your long awaited vacation will not be ruined due to unforeseen breakdowns! After five years in the private luxury yacht charter scene, he is well seasoned in what it takes to provide a high quality, luxury charter.
Olivia started cooking at a young age and through the years has developed a wholesome culinary style that is sure to satisfy after a busy day on the water. With more than 10 years experience in the hospitality industry and through managerial roles she knows what it takes to provide quality service. Olivia became fluent in Spanish while living in Spain at 18 and is keen to practice her skills with any Spanish speaking guests. As a family, Fraser and Olivia sailed their previous catamaran, an Outremer 45, from NZ to Fiji which they then circumnavigated and then returned to NZ. Over the six month trip Olivia developed great practical sailing knowledge. Olivia is also a marine biologist and a keen water woman who is currently learning to surf and spearfish when she isn’t either homeschooling their three gorgeous kids or completing the many daily tasks she is responsible for with a life at sea.
